Dolphins' Patrick Paul emerges as key breakout candidate for 2026
Summary

Miami Dolphins offensive lineman Patrick Paul has been identified as a potential breakout player for the 2026 season by ESPN analyst Benjamin Solak. The Dolphins, with a young roster following significant offseason changes, are looking for players to step up. Paul is expected to benefit from playing alongside first-round pick Kadyn Proctor and center Aaron Brewer, which could solidify the left side of the offensive line. After a challenging rookie season in 2024, Paul showed improvement in 2025, achieving a 66.2 overall grade from Pro Football Focus. This season will be crucial for him to establish his role within the team as he approaches the final year of his rookie contract in 2027.

By the Numbers
  • Patrick Paul is a second-round draft pick from 2024.
  • He earned All-Conference honors three times at Houston.
  • Dolphins aim to secure the left side of the line with Proctor and Brewer.
  • Paul received a 66.2 grade from Pro Football Focus in 2025.
